Sourcing guidance for Top 10 Enzymes
What are the key technical specifications to consider when sourcing industrial enzymes?
When purchasing enzymes such as Amylase, Protease, or Cellulase, you must prioritize Enzyme Activity (U/g or U/mL), which defines the product's potency. Ensure the supplier provides the Optimal pH Range and Temperature Stability data, as these factors determine if the enzyme will function correctly in your specific application (e.g., textile processing vs. food fermentation). Additionally, verify the Purity Level and the presence of any carrier substances.
Which compliance standards are mandatory for food-grade and pharmaceutical enzymes?
For food-grade enzymes (like Lactase or Pectinase), suppliers must adhere to FCC (Food Chemicals Codex) or JECFA standards. Ensure the manufacturer holds ISO 22000 or HACCP certifications for food safety. If you are exporting to the US or EU, check for FDA GRAS (Generally Recognized as Safe) status or EFSA evaluation. For specialized markets, Halal and Kosher certifications are often essential requirements.
How can I evaluate the stability and shelf life of enzyme products?
Enzymes are biologically active and sensitive to environmental factors. Request Accelerated Stability Test Reports from the supplier to understand the Loss of Activity Rate over time. High-quality suppliers will provide specific Storage Requirements (e.g., refrigeration at 4°C or airtight containers) and use Advanced Formulation Technologies like micro-encapsulation to extend shelf life and maintain efficacy during transport.
What are the typical usage scenarios for the top 10 industrial enzymes?
Enzymes serve diverse industries: Proteases and Lipases are critical for the Detergent Industry to break down stains; Amylases and Glucoamylases are vital for Ethanol Production and Baking; Cellulases are used in Textile Bio-polishing; and Phytase is a key additive in the Animal Feed Industry to improve nutrient absorption. Matching the specific enzyme strain to your industry application is crucial for cost-efficiency.
Cross-Border Procurement Strategies for Enzymes
What are the primary risks when shipping enzymes internationally?
The biggest risk is Thermal Degradation. Enzymes can lose bio-activity if exposed to high temperatures in shipping containers. It is highly recommended to use Cold Chain Logistics or Temperature-Controlled Containers (Reefers). Always request Temperature Data Loggers to be included in the shipment to verify that the products remained within the required temperature range throughout transit.

What documentation is required for customs clearance of biological enzymes?
Customs often scrutinize biological products. You must prepare a detailed Certificate of Analysis (COA), a Material Safety Data Sheet (MSDS), and a Non-GMO Declaration if applicable. Some countries require a Health Certificate or an Import Permit for Biological Substances. Ensure the HS Code (typically under Chapter 3507) is correctly classified to avoid delays or incorrect duty applications.
